#d493b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d493bd is composed of 83.1% red, 57.6%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.7% magenta, 10.8%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 321.2 degrees, a saturation of 43% and a lightness of 70.4%. #d493bd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a9277b.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#d493bd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d493bd has RGB values of R:212, G:147,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.11,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13931453.
